Con-Rod
Removal
1.
Remove piston with con-rod according to the
corresponding operation.
2.
Disassemble con-rod piston assembly by pressing out
piston pin, using 5-8840-0468-0.
Installation
1.
Slide guide drift (5-8840-0468-0) in horizontal position
through piston and con-rod as far as side plate stops.
2.
Tighten bolts evenly so that the piston rests flush on the
rear plate.
3.
Remove centre piece from guide drift and insert piston
bolts (lubricated) into guide drift.
ENGINE MECHANICAL (C22NE, 22LE, 20LE) 6A-55
4.
Heat a new con-rod to 280
°
C in the oil bath.
5.
Install the con-rod to the piston and insert the piston pin.
Important!
Since the con-rods have no weight balancing studs, re-working
is not possible.
Exchange con-rods in sets only.
Installation position, beads on con-rod point to the flattening on
the piston pin eye.
Firmly seated piston pin cannot be pushed in. Carry out
installation quickly.
Piston Rings
Removal
1.
Remove piston with con-rod according to the
corresponding operation.
2.
Remove piston rings using commercially available ring
installer or piston ring clamp pliers.
Clean
Piston ring grooves - ground piece of old piston ring
Inspection
Piston ring gap
For piston ring sizes, permissible piston ring gaps - see
"Technical Data"
6A-56 ENGINE MECHANICAL (C22NE, 22LE, 20LE)
Installation
1.
Install oil scraper ring.
2.
Offset ring gaps of steel band rings each 25 to 50 mm/1
to 2in. to the left or right of the intermediate ring gap.
3.
Install piston rings.
4.
Offset ring gaps by approx. 180
°
.
5.
Install second piston ring with identification mark "TOP"
facing upwards.
6.
Install piston with con-rod according to the corresponding
operation.
